Gluten Freedom is the new book written by Dr. Alessio Fasano, MD, the founder and director of the Center for Celiac Research at Massachusetts General Hospital, and world-renowned pediatric gastroenterologist. The book is co-authored by Susie Flaherty, former senior editor at the University of Maryland and currently the communications director of the Center for Celiac Research.  Dr. Fasano is a leading expert in the field of Celiac Disease (CD) and Non-Celiac Gluten Sensitivity (NCGS) and Gluten Freedom is an absolute must-read for anyone with Celiac Disease or Gluten Sensitivity.

 

“Thus, at the beginning of this journey, I had to explain constantly to my colleagues how to spell the word “celiac.” When I started writing this book several years ago, I was using an older version of Microsoft Word. Every time I wrote the word “celiac,” it was underlined in red, which is the symbol of a misspelled or unrecognized word. Now I use a new version of Microsoft Word that recognizes “celiac” in its spelling dictionary. The word celiac has finally made it into the popular lexicon. And although it might seem like a small thing, to me it’s a fitting symbol of how the awareness of celiac disease and gluten-related disorders has grown so much in such a brief span of time”.  We have Dr. Fasano and his team to thank for putting Celiac Disease on the US medical map, convincing physicians that this auto-immune disease actually existed in North America!

Gluten Freedom is presented in four parts, each part containing several chapters filled with essential information on CD and NCGS. Dr. Fasano writes in easy to understand language, and makes even the most biological concepts compelling!

(from book cover) “Distinguishing scientific fact from myth, Gluten Freedom explains the latest research, diagnostic procedures, and treatment/diet recommendations, helping consumers make the best choices for themselves and their families. Gluten Freedom also discusses important nutritional implications for behavior-related diagnoses such as autism and conditions such as depression, anxiety, and “foggy mind”.

Chapters include: “Gluten Gets Into the Gut – and Other Places”; The Spectrum of Gluten-Related Disorders; Getting the Right Diagnosis; Gluten-Free Cooking and Dining; Pregnancy and the Gluten-Free Diet; Getting Through College Gluten-Free; Gluten in the Golden Years; New Treatments and Therapies and much more.

The book also offers valuable information on how to live a healthy, gluten free lifestyle, and includes recipes!
